Autumn's vibrant colours and cosy atmosphere make it an inspiring time for arts and crafts. Whether you're decorating your home or making gifts, there are lots of innovative jobs to enjoy this season.
Producing autumn-themed designs is an enjoyable method to commemorate the season inside your home. You can collect natural elements like leaves, acorns, and pinecones to make wreaths, garlands, or table centrepieces. Crafting designs enables you to bring the charm of autumn into your home, producing a warm and welcoming environment. Making your own designs is also affordable, adding a personal touch to your space without needing store-bought products. This pastime motivates imagination and resourcefulness, turning normal fall discovers into distinct and lovely home accents.
Watercolour painting is another fantastic autumn craft, ideal for capturing the season's beautiful landscapes. The abundant reds, oranges, and yellows of fall are best for painting scenes influenced by forests, mountains, or parks. Watercolours enable soft blending, capturing the essence of autumn's misty early mornings and golden afternoons. Even if you're brand-new to painting, fall offers unlimited inspiration, making it easy to explore colours and strategies. Painting is a soothing, meditative activity, enabling you to delight in autumn's appeal while developing something significant.
Finally, candle making is a fall pastime that includes warmth and a personal touch to your home. Developing homemade candle lights lets you try out scents like cinnamon, apple, or vanilla, which are perfect for the season. Making candle lights can be a fulfilling, hands-on activity, leading to items that you can use or present to others. Candle light making offers creative liberty with colours, shapes, and scents, enabling you to craft candles that show your character and taste.
